IN NO EVENT SHALL THE +AUTHORS OR COPYRIGHT HOLDERS BE LIABLE FOR ANY CLAIM, DAMAGES OR OTHER +LIABILITY, WHETHER IN AN ACTION OF CONTRACT, TORT OR OTHERWISE, ARISING FROM, +OUT OF OR IN CONNECTION WITH THE SOFTWARE OR THE USE OR OTHER DEALINGS IN THE +SOFTWARE. diff --git a/README.md b/README.md new file mode 100644 index 0000000..7ef28da --- /dev/null +++ b/README.md @@ -0,0 +1,83 @@ +# breadlock + +Session locker and graphical [greetd](https://git.sr.ht/~kennylevinsen/greetd) greeter for [Hyprland](https://hyprland.org/) on Wayland — the bread-ecosystem replacement for `hyprlock` and the TUI greeter (`tuigreet`) BOS currently ships. + +Two binaries, one workspace: + +- **`breadlock`** — locks the *already running* Hyprland session via `ext-session-lock-v1`. Drop-in for `hyprlock`. +- **`breadgreet`** — a graphical greeter that speaks `greetd`'s own IPC protocol (the same architecture as `gtkgreet`/`regreet`). `greetd` keeps owning PAM auth, VT switching, and session launching; `breadgreet` only draws the login UI and relays the conversation. This is a deliberate choice over reimplementing a display manager from scratch — `greetd` is already installed and battle-tested. + +Both use [`bread-theme`](https://github.com/Breadway/bread-ecosystem) for palette loading, matching the rest of the bread* ecosystem (breadbar, breadbox, bos-settings). + +## Architecture + +``` +breadlock/ +├── breadlock-ui/ shared: bread-theme wrapper, TOML config, .desktop parsing, +│ software-rendering primitives (tiny-skia + cosmic-text, +│ behind the "paint" feature — only breadlock needs them) +├── breadlock/ the locker (SCTK + PAM) +└── breadgreet/ the greeter (GTK4 + relm4 + greetd_ipc) +``` + +### breadlock + +- **Protocol**: `ext-session-lock-v1` via [`smithay-client-toolkit`](https://docs.rs/smithay-client-toolkit) — GTK has no session-lock support, so this is a raw Wayland client, not a layer-shell surface like breadbar. +- **Rendering**: fully software — `tiny-skia` composites each frame (background, rounded password pill, clock, status line) into a `wl_shm` buffer; `cosmic-text` shapes and rasterizes text (loads "Varela Round" by family name). No EGL/GL. +- **Background**: a solid palette color or a static PNG (cover-fit). Live blur-of-desktop (hyprlock-style) is a **v2 follow-up** — it needs a `wlr-screencopy` capture (`libwayshot` is the right crate when this gets picked up); `background.blur = true` is accepted today but just logs a warning. +- **Auth**: [`pam-client2`](https://crates.io/crates/pam-client2) against the `breadlock` PAM service (`packaging/pam.d/breadlock`, installed to `/etc/pam.d/breadlock` by the package). Runs on its own OS thread — libpam's conversation callback is blocking FFI — and reports back through a `calloop::channel` registered on the render loop. + +### breadgreet + +- **Protocol**: [`greetd_ipc`](https://crates.io/crates/greetd_ipc) (greetd's own crate) over the Unix socket at `$GREETD_SOCK`: `CreateSession` → answer each `AuthMessage` via `PostAuthMessageResponse` → `StartSession` hands the resolved session command to `greetd`, which execs it and owns the VT switch away. +- **UI**: GTK4 + [relm4](https://relm4.org/), matching breadbar's stack — **without** `gtk4-layer-shell`. `greetd` hosts the greeter under a single-client kiosk compositor (`cage -s`), which already fullscreens its one client, so layer-shell's multi-surface/anchor semantics don't apply. Confirmed against ReGreet's real dependency list, which has no layer-shell dependency either. +- **Sessions**: scans `/usr/share/wayland-sessions` and `/usr/share/xsessions` for `.desktop` entries and auto-selects the configured default (or the only one found). BOS ships one session today, so there's no picker UI in v1 — a natural v2 addition if that changes. + +## Config + +Copy [`breadlock.example.toml`](breadlock.example.toml) to `~/.config/breadlock/breadlock.toml` and [`breadgreet.example.toml`](breadgreet.example.toml) to `/etc/greetd/breadgreet.toml` (or `~/.config/breadgreet/breadgreet.toml` for local testing under a normal session — `breadgreet` checks the system path first since it typically runs as the dedicated `greeter` user). Every field is optional; both binaries run with sensible defaults and no config at all. + +## Building + +```sh +cargo build --release --bin breadlock --bin breadgreet +cargo test --workspace +``` + +Requires GTK4 (≥ 4.12), `libxkbcommon`, and PAM development headers. On Arch: + +```sh +sudo pacman -S gtk4 wayland libxkbcommon pam rust cargo +``` + +`breadlock-auth-check` is a third, dev-only binary in the `breadlock` package (see Verification below) — not installed by the package, build it explicitly with `cargo build --bin breadlock-auth-check` if you need it. + +## Packaging + +`packaging/arch/PKGBUILD` builds and installs both binaries plus `/etc/pam.d/breadlock`. `bakery.toml` is the bread-ecosystem package index entry. + +**Not included, by design**: this repo does not touch `/etc/greetd/config.toml`, install a lock keybind, or wire up `hypridle`. Once packaged, wiring BOS to actually use these binaries means: + +```toml +# /etc/greetd/config.toml — replace the current tuigreet line +[default_session] +command = "cage -s -- breadgreet" +``` + +``` +# hyprland.conf +bind = SUPER, L, exec, breadlock +``` + +That's a separate, later BOS task — deliberately kept out of this change so the existing `tuigreet` login path stays untouched and available as a fallback while these binaries are tested. + +## Verification (why this is safe to test without a lockout risk) + +1. **PAM logic in isolation first**: `cargo run --bin breadlock-auth-check` exercises the exact PAM flow `breadlock` uses, against a typed password, with **no Wayland surface at all**. A bad `/etc/pam.d/breadlock` just prints an error here — it can never lock a session. +2. **Locker rendering/lock lifecycle nested, never against the live session**: run `breadlock` inside a nested Hyprland instance or under `cage -- breadlock`. `ext-session-lock-v1` only ever affects the compositor instance the client is connected to (scoped to `$WAYLAND_DISPLAY`), so a nested lock can never lock the real outer session. Verify the full type-password → PAM check → unlock cycle there, including the wrong-password path, before ever binding a real keybind. +3. **If testing against a live session**: keep a second TTY or SSH session open the whole time. Killing the `breadlock` process is **not** a safe unlock path — per the protocol, an abnormally-terminated lock client is expected to leave the compositor still locked. The real recovery path is "kill it, then use the second session to restart Hyprland or switch VT." +4. **breadgreet**: `cargo test -p breadgreet` runs the `greetd_ipc` framing/state-machine tests against a mock Unix-socket server — no real `greetd` or PAM involved. Manual testing against a real `greetd` should happen on a disposable VT, leaving the existing `tuigreet` config on VT1 untouched as a fallback. + +## License + +MIT diff --git a/bakery.toml b/bakery.toml new file mode 100644 index 0000000..4674b71 --- /dev/null +++ b/bakery.toml @@ -0,0 +1,15 @@ +name = "breadlock" +description = "Session locker and greetd greeter for Hyprland / Wayland" +binaries = ["breadlock", "breadgreet"] +system_deps = ["pam", "wayland", "libxkbcommon", "gtk4"] +optional_system_deps = ["cage", "hyprland"] +bread_deps = [] + +[config] +dir = "~/.config/breadlock" +example = "breadlock.example.toml" + +[install] +post_install = [ + "echo 'breadlock installed. /etc/pam.d/breadlock is installed by the package; wiring greetd (cage -s -- breadgreet) and a lock keybind/hypridle is a separate manual step.'", +] diff --git a/breadgreet.example.toml b/breadgreet.example.toml new file mode 100644 index 0000000..c5f2093 --- /dev/null +++ b/breadgreet.example.toml @@ -0,0 +1,26 @@ +# breadgreet commonly runs as the dedicated `greeter` system user (per +# greetd's own convention), so it checks /etc/greetd/breadgreet.toml first; +# copy this there for a real install.
